This will be brief, because I'm exhausted. Spent the day at Virginia Internat'l Raceway flogging the entire SRT line (well, except the Viper, but I'm not terribly disappointed). About as much fun as you can have with all your clothes on...morning was "Meh" with the slalom and autocross stuff on a space too small for the size of the cars....BUT...the entire afternoon was hot laps on the "full" VIR course...in a Grand Cherokee SRT (fun for what it is), the SRT Challenger, Charger and the awesome surprise...the easiest car to drive fast and a total surprise...the Chrysler 300 SRT! (also, the instructor for those sessions, which I did over and over was more aggressive than the other instructor/drivers, very communicative and I had good rapport with. I drove Challengers 2 times, but learned a lot more on the 300 and from the guy (generally leading 2 cars). He also gave me a separate briefing lap which paid off immediately.

Right now, I is tired, have a blister on my ankle (from BRAKING...all cars are automatics...and we work those brakes hard) cooling down from a hot day out after a shower and there's a triple Wild Turkey in my immediate future. And yes, I have videos (they have a two camera system for view forward and the driver in small window). My session came with my Challenger, but 700 bucks will buy anyone entry and I HIGHLY recommend it. I'm sure my skills took a quantum leap (and you can explore limits more assuredly at the safety of a big track like VIR). I see a membership there in the near future (it operates as a country club, but for cars).
